Touring cycling around San Vito Sullo Ionio features routes that navigate the hilly terrain of Calabria, characterized by significant elevation changes and diverse landscapes. The region includes areas within natural parks, offering routes through forested sections and along scenic valleys. Many trails provide views of the Ionian Sea, connecting inland villages with coastal perspectives. The network of routes caters to cyclists seeking challenging climbs and rewarding descents.

There are 19 touring cycling routes documented on komoot for the San Vito Sullo Ionio region, offering a variety of experiences through its hilly terrain and diverse landscapes.
The touring cycling routes around San Vito Sullo Ionio are primarily designed for experienced cyclists due to the hilly terrain and significant elevation changes. There are 3 moderate routes available, but no easy routes are currently listed, making it less ideal for beginners or young families seeking flat, easy rides.
You can expect a diverse range of landscapes, including routes through natural parks, forested sections, and scenic valleys. Many trails also offer rewarding views of the Ionian Sea, connecting inland villages with coastal perspectives.
Yes, many routes in the area are designed as loops. For example, the challenging Valley View – Fosso del Lupo Pass loop from Filadelfia offers a 31.5 km ride with significant elevation, providing a full circular experience.
The region offers several points of interest. You might encounter natural features like Lake Angitola or the summit of Monte Covello. Historical sites such as the Grotto of Our Lady of Lourdes are also present. Some routes, like The castle of Baroness Scoppa da Cardinale – loop tour, specifically highlight historical points of interest.
Given the region's Mediterranean climate, spring (April-May) and autumn (September-October) generally offer the most pleasant temperatures for touring cycling, avoiding the intense heat of summer while still enjoying good weather. Summer can be very hot, especially on routes with significant climbs.
Yes, many touring cycling routes in San Vito Sullo Ionio are designed to provide scenic views of the Ionian Sea, particularly as they connect inland areas with coastal perspectives. The Monterosso – View of the sea in Pizzo loop from Monterosso Calabro is an example of a route that specifically highlights coastal vistas.
The majority of touring cycling routes around San Vito Sullo Ionio are rated as 'difficult'. Out of 19 routes, 16 are difficult, and 3 are moderate. This indicates that cyclists should be prepared for challenging climbs and descents due to the region's hilly topography.
The touring cycling routes in San Vito Sullo Ionio are highly regarded by the komoot community, holding an average rating of 4.5 stars from over 20 reviews. Cyclists often praise the challenging nature of the terrain and the rewarding scenic views.
Yes, the region includes areas within natural parks, and some routes navigate through these protected landscapes. The From San Nicola da Crissa to Mongiana along the Calabria Parks Cycle Route – loop tour is a prime example, exploring the natural beauty of the Calabria Parks.
One of the longest routes is the Serra San Bruno – Serra San Bruno loop from San Vito sullo Ionio, which covers approximately 69.3 km (43.0 miles) and typically takes around 4 hours and 50 minutes to complete through mountainous landscapes.
